The Oklahoma City VA Healthcare System (OCVAHCS) is actively recruiting a board-certified, board-eligible full-time permanent hospital employed Pulmonologist- critical care and sleep medicine to join our Pulmonary department. The Physician is accountable to the Chief of Pulmonary Service. The Pulmonary physician participates in inpatient and outpatient care related to pulmonary diseases, disorders and critical care diseases at the OKC VA. The Pulmonary and Sleep Medicine practice provides consultation and management for a wide variety of pulmonary and sleep related disorders. Pulmonary specific responsibilities include clinic-based visits, hospital consults and pulmonary procedures (diagnostic bronchoscopy and basic pleural procedures). Sleep specific responsibilities include management of sleep related breathing disorders and interpretation of overnight oximetry. If candidate has additional sleep training, other opportunities include polysomnogram interpretation, management of sleep behavior disorders, parasomnias, insomnia and restless legs. Critical Care Medicine responsibilities include primary management of critically ill medical and surgical patients. Responsibilities include participating in the education and supervision of trainees, participating in the inpatient and outpatient quality care, teaching and researching related to pulmonary/critical care diseases, especially pulmonary hypertension, performing routine and advanced bronchoscopic and pleural procedures, including EBUS and bedside ultrasound as well as applying national and VA guidelines to patient screening, surveillance and management.
